Łukasz Tumicz (born March 1, 1985 in Lidzbark Warmiński) is a Polish football forward.

Club

Prior to becoming a professional, Tumicz played college soccer at the University of Rhode Island, wearing #31. He also played for the Rhode Island Stingrays during the summers. He was selected 34th overall in the 2008 MLS Supplemental Draft by Columbus Crew, but he did not sign a developmental contract.
He scored his first goal in the Polish premier league on April 12, 2008 against Wisła Kraków.
In March 2009, following extended health problems, Jagiellonia loaned him out to Supraślanka Supraśl in order to regain fitness.
In January 2011, he joined Górnik Polkowice on a one and a half year contract.
In July 2011, he signed a contract with Olimpia Grudziądz.
